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
TensorFlow versions prior to 2.12.0
TensorFlow versions prior to 2.11.1
Description
The issue occurs when
SparseSparseMaximum is given invalid sparse tensors as inputs, resulting in a null pointer error. This is a problem in the TensorFlow open source platform for machine learning.Recommendations
For versions prior to 2.12.0, update to TensorFlow version 2.12 or later.
For versions prior to 2.11.1, update to TensorFlow version 2.11.1 or later.
As a temporary workaround, consider avoiding the use of
SparseSparseMaximum with invalid sparse tensors until a patch is applied.Exploit
